Shadcn.io is not affiliated with official shadcn/ui
React Notification Preferences Settings Block
Animated React notification preferences settings page for Next.js with per-category email, push, and SMS toggles using shadcn/ui Switch, Tailwind CSS, and framer-motion
Configure granular notification preferences with this React and Next.js settings block. Organize notification channels -- email, push, and SMS -- by category with independent toggles for each. Built with TypeScript, shadcn/ui Switch and Button, Tailwind CSS, and framer-motion staggered animations.
React Notification Preferences Settings Block preview
Installation
Related Components
Profile Settings
Name, email, bio, and avatar management
Email Preferences
Frequency, digest, and unsubscribe controls
Security Settings
Password, 2FA, and session management
Privacy Settings
Data sharing and cookie preferences
Appearance Settings
Theme, font size, and density controls
Integrations
Connected OAuth apps and services
FAQ
Was this page helpful?
Sign in to leave feedback.
React Notification Channel Routing Settings Block
Animated React notification channel routing settings page for Next.js with Slack, email, PagerDuty, and webhook configuration plus event-to-channel mapping built with shadcn/ui, Tailwind CSS, and framer-motion
React OAuth Application Management Settings Block
React animated OAuth app management settings block for Next.js with client credentials display, redirect URI configuration, scope selection, and secret rotation using shadcn/ui, Tailwind CSS, and framer-motion